câine
Romanian

Câine
Alternative forms
- cîine (alternative orthography; predominates in Moldova)
- câne (chiefly Moldavia).Compare Aromanian cãne.
- кыйне (Moldovan Cyrillic spelling)
Etymology
From Latin canis, canem, from Proto-Italic *kō (accusative *kwanem), from Proto-Indo-European *ḱwṓ (accusative *ḱwónm̥). Compare Aromanian cãni.
Pronunciation
- IPA(key): /ˈkɨj.ne/
